The Advantix 4100 ix zoom is a compact zoom camera mad eby Kodak for the APS film system in about 1996.[1]
Specifications
- Type: 35mm compact camera
- Manufacturer: Eastman Kodak Co.
- Lens: 1:4.5-1:8.5/30-60mm zoom lens, glass hybrid aspheric
- Shutter: programmed electronic shutter with speeds 1/6 - 1/270 sec.
- Focusing: active autofocus (infrared?)
- Films: APS films with speeds 50 upto 1600 ASA
- Viewfinder: real image finder with parallax marks and autofocus indicator
- Flash: flash on, off or automatic, long time synchronization
- Dimensions: 124 x 64 x 39 mm
- Weight: 230g without film and CR123A 3V battery
Notes
- ↑ The user's manual at Kodak (linked below) includes a 1995 copyright statement; however, the Advantix cameras were not introduced until 1996.
